How to Get Verified in Under an Hour (My Lazy Method)

I’m not a tech wizard. I just want to click a button and get on with it. So here’s my no-brain guide to getting through the KYC (that’s ‘Know Your Customer’, which is just a fancy term for ‘prove you’re you’) as fast as possible for any of the top UK brands like Casumo or Mr Green.

  1. Have your documents ready. Don’t start the sign-up and then hunt around for your passport. Have a photo of your driving license and a recent bank statement (PDF is best) saved on your phone. Do this first.
  2. Upload everything at once. Don’t just upload your ID and wait for them to ask for proof of address. They will ask. Beat them to it. Upload your ID, your utility bill, and your card photo all in one go. It cuts the back-and-forth emails completely.
  3. Check your email (yes, even the spam folder). They will send you a link or a message. I’ve missed two verification confirmations because they went straight to spam. Don’t be me. Check your junk mail for ‘Verification’ or ‘KYC’.
  4. Use a site with ‘Instant Verification’. Some sites, like LeoVegas or Unibet, use a third-party service that checks your ID against a database instantly. It’s not perfect, but it’s faster than waiting for a human. Look for that option when you sign up.

FAQ: The Questions You’re Too Embarrassed to Ask

What documents do I actually need for a UKGC casino?

Usually, just a copy of your passport or driving license, and a recent utility bill (gas, electric, or a bank statement) showing your name and address. Sometimes they ask for a photo of your debit card. That’s it. Nothing crazy.

How long does verification take on the best secure online casino 2026 uk licensed picks?

From my experience, it varies wildly. Sites like Betway can take up to 48 hours. Others like LeoVegas or Unibet often do it in under 6 hours if you upload clear documents. If it’s taking longer than 24 hours, just send a polite email to support. Usually speeds them up.

Can I play before I’m verified?

Yes, usually you can deposit and play. But you cannot withdraw until you are fully verified. So if you win big on your first spin, you’ll have to go through the process anyway. Best to just do it upfront.

What happens if my documents get rejected?

They’ll tell you why. Usually it’s because the photo is blurry, the document is expired, or the address doesn’t match what you put on the form. Just take a better photo and try again. It’s annoying but normal.

Wagering Requirements as a Hidden Tax on Your Bankroll

A £100 bonus with a 40x wagering requirement means you must place £4,000 in bets before you can withdraw any winnings derived from that bonus. If the slot you play has an RTP of 96%, the expected loss during wagering is £160, which is more than the bonus itself. This is why the effective value of most welcome offers is negative for the player who understands expected value. The exceptions are the wager-free promotions offered by Sky Vegas and PlayOJO. Sky Vegas gives 250 free spins with no wagering attached , anything you win is yours immediately. PlayOJO offers 50 wager-free spins on Big Bass Bonanza, which has a published RTP of 96% according to eCOGRA testing. These offers are the only mathematically sound way to extract positive expected value from a casino signup.

Banking Options and Speed Comparisons

E-wallet withdrawals are consistently faster than card withdrawals across all operators we tested. PayPal and Skrill cleared in 14 to 20 hours at MrQ, Mecca Bingo, and Coral, while Visa debit cards took between one and three business days. The fastest operator for e-wallet payouts was Bet365, with funds arriving in under 24 hours in every test instance. For players who prioritise speed, depositing via e-wallet and withdrawing via the same method is the optimal strategy. Card withdrawals are slower because the operator must process the transaction through the Visa or Mastercard network, which adds a clearing day. Minimum deposit thresholds vary from £10 at Sky Vegas, PlayOJO, Coral, and William Hill to £20 at MrQ, 32Red, and 888 Casino. The lower threshold is preferable for bankroll management, as it allows you to test the platform with minimal capital at risk.
